Selling Items You Already Own

Converting unused personal belongings into cash can be a direct path to immediate funds. Begin by assessing items around your home that are no longer needed but retain some value. This could include electronics, designer clothing, books, or even unused gift cards.

For quick sales, consider local options such as consignment shops for clothing or electronics stores that purchase used devices. Pawn shops also offer immediate cash for collateralized items, though this involves a loan with interest charges. Online marketplaces that facilitate local pickup can also be effective, allowing you to list items with clear photos and concise descriptions for rapid transactions. Pricing items competitively, often 25% to 50% below retail for used goods, helps attract immediate buyers.

Completing Local Gigs and Services

Engaging in local gigs and services offers a hands-on approach to earning money quickly within your community. Common opportunities include babysitting, pet sitting, yard work, house cleaning, or helping with moving tasks. These services can often be arranged for immediate payment, providing direct access to funds. Income earned from these activities is generally considered self-employment income.

To find these opportunities, leverage neighborhood social media groups, community boards, or simply spread the word among friends and family. Local task-based applications can also connect you with individuals needing immediate help, often allowing for direct communication and quick agreement on terms. When negotiating, aim for a fair price that reflects the immediate nature of the work, such as $15 to $30 per hour for general labor or a flat fee for specific tasks like mowing a lawn. Always communicate your availability clearly and confirm the payment method before starting the work.

Engaging in Online Activities

Several online platforms provide opportunities to earn money through short-term tasks that can offer relatively quick payouts. Participating in online surveys is one method, where companies pay for consumer opinions on products or services. While individual survey payouts are often small, ranging from $0.50 to $5 per survey, completing several can accumulate funds over a short period. Payment for these activities is generally provided through digital platforms like PayPal, direct bank transfers, or gift cards, often within a few days to a week.

Micro-task websites also offer small, discrete tasks such as data entry, image tagging, or content moderation, which can be completed quickly for a small fee per task. Platforms specializing in short-term freelance work may also present opportunities for basic transcription or online focus groups. All income earned from online activities is taxable.
